Zeichencodes
6.4.5
Initialisierung
Eine Kommunikation zwischen externem Rechner und Servoverstärker ist erst nach Abschluss
des internen Initialisierungsvorgangs des Servoverstärkers möglich.
Vor einem Kommunikationsvorgang müssen:
● 1 s nach Einschalten der Versorgungsspannung vergangen sein
● die Parametereinstellungen und Daten eingelesen und überprüft werden
6.4.6
Kommunikationsbeispiel
Beispiel
Im folgenden Beispiel wird der letzte Alarm aus der Alarmliste der Station 0 in den Rechner
eingelesen.
Einstellung
Stationsnummer
Befehl
Daten-Nr.
Tab. 6-5: Einstellbeispiel
Nein
Abb. 6-12: Ablauf eines Kommunikationsvorganges
MELSERVO J3-A
Wert
0
33
10
Start
Dateneingabe
Prüfsummenberechnung
Kopf hinzufügen
Übertragungsdaten erstellen
Datenübertragung
Datenempfang
Daten
empfangen?
Ja
Andere Meldung als
Fehler [A] oder [a]?
3 Versuche?
Empfangsdatenanalyse
Ja
Fehler
Ende
Beschreibung
Servoverstärker Station Nr. 0
Lesebefehl
Letzter Alarm der Alarmliste
Daten:
Prüfsumme:
Übertragungsdaten: SOH
Nein
Ja
300 ms vergangen?
Ja
3 Versuche?
Ja
100 ms nach Übertragung von EOT
Fehler
Nein
Kommunikation
Station
Befehl
Daten-Nr.
0
3
3
STX
1
0
ETX
30h
+33h +33h +02h +31h +30h +03h =FCh
0
3
3
STX
1
0
ETX
Master → Slave
Master ← Slave
Nein
Nein
Master → Slave
F
C
S000760C
6 - 9